Westcon out to woo VARs with services portfolio

by This email address is being protected from spam bots, you need Javascript enabled to view it  on Thursday, 09 October 2008
Steve Lockie insists ServiceVantage will give VARs the support they need to grow their business

Networking distribution group Westcon Middle East has rolled out the first phase of a portfolio of trade-only partner services designed to provide resellers with immediate support.

Dubbed ‘ServiceVantage’, the offering is available through subsidiaries OnLine Distribution and Comstor, and will provide modules that assist resellers in design, planning and implementation projects.

Steve Lockie, group managing director at Westcon Middle East, believes the portfolio will help networking VARs to develop their business.

“We believe that as the Middle East’s channel market matures, distributors who remain competitive will be those offering products and associated value-added services that support and allow partners to grow and specialise in areas where they can be indispensable to their customers,” he explained.

“Our vision as a group remains to consistently exceed partner expectations through the quality delivery of these exclusively through the channel,” added Lockie.

ServiceVantage comprises a number of components, including initiatives that promise design and quote assistance, project management services, jumpstart services, front-line assistance and remote technical support.

One reseller that claims to have benefited from the portfolio is Qatar-based infrastructure VAR EMEA Enterprise Solutions, which recently called upon Westcon’s team for pre-installation consultancy and implementation support.

“ServiceVantage proved to be a great asset to both our delivery of product and our client’s operation,” insisted Richard Ian Yarnall, technical infrastructure practice manager at the company. “The partnership between our own engineers and the expertise the Vantage team provided enhanced both our service capabilities and profile with the client.”
